Staten Islanders Dominate at New York Relays

At the New York Relays, Staten Islanders showcased their exceptional abilities in track and field. Susan Wagner’s Jaice Dorsey, bound for Northeastern University, displayed her talent by matching her Island record with a remarkable 14.23-second victory in the 100-meter hurdles. Her teammate, Mia Petersen, triumphed in the long jump with an impressive personal-best leap of 17 feet, 7 inches, ranking as the eighth-best performance in Island history. Tottenville’s Kory Brown also emerged victorious, while Monsignor Farrell’s 4×800-meter relay team secured the gold medal.
